Offering a swimming pool, Pingo Premium Apartment is situated about 15 minutes by car from Seven Colored Earth. Car hire is available at this apartment and the area is popular for diving, surfing, and hiking.
Location
A 25-minute walk will take you to Crystal Rock. Ebony Forest Reserve Chamarel is also situated about 10 minutes by car from the apartment.
Rooms
Furnished with a sofa set, Pingo Premium Apartment comprises a balcony and a sitting area fitted with air conditioning. Within the in-room media amenities, there is a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Every bathroom is equipped with a separate toilet and a shower. Hair dryers and bath sheets can also be found.
Eat & Drink
An open kitchen is complete with tea and coffee-making facilities, as well as a refrigerator, an oven, and kitchenware essential for self-catering.
Leisure & Business
Guests can enhance their relaxation experience at this property with access to a sundeck, a shared lounge, and a golf course, providing the epitome of luxury.
